Black hole bombs and explosions: from astrophysics to particle physics

Cardoso, Vitor

Understand

Black holes are the elementary particles of gravity, the final state of sufficiently massive stars and of energetic collisions.

  • With a forty-year long history, black hole physics is a fully-blossomed field which promises to embrace several branches of theoretical physics.
  • Here I review the main developments in highly dynamical black holes with an emphasis on high energy black hole collisions and probes of particle physics via superradiance.
  • This write-up, rather than being a collection of well known results, is intended to highlight open issues and the most intriguing results.
